  1. /** @file
  2. Implementation of Fsp Me Policy Initialization.
  3. Copyright (c) 2020, Intel Corporation. All rights reserved.<BR>
  4. SPDX-License-Identifier: BSD-2-Clause-Patent
  5. **/
  6. #include <PeiFspPolicyInitLib.h>
  7. #include <ConfigBlock/MePeiConfig.h>
  8. #include <Ppi/SiPolicy.h>
  9. #include <Library/ConfigBlockLib.h>
  10. /**
  11. Performs FSP ME PEI Policy pre mem initialization.
  12. @param[in][out] FspmUpd Pointer to FSP UPD Data.
  13. @retval EFI_SUCCESS FSP UPD Data is updated.
  14. @retval EFI_NOT_FOUND Fail to locate required PPI.
  15. @retval Other FSP UPD Data update process fail.
  16. **/
  17. EFI_STATUS
  18. EFIAPI
  19. PeiFspMePolicyInitPreMem (
  20. IN OUT FSPM_UPD *FspmUpd
  21. )
  22. {
  23. EFI_STATUS Status;
  24. SI_PREMEM_POLICY_PPI *SiPreMemPolicy;
  25. ME_PEI_PREMEM_CONFIG *MePeiPreMemConfig;
  26. DEBUG ((DEBUG_INFO, "PeiFspMePolicyInitPreMem\n"));
  27. //
  28. // Locate gSiPreMemPolicyPpi
  29. //
  30. SiPreMemPolicy = NULL;
  31. Status = PeiServicesLocatePpi (
  32. &gSiPreMemPolicyPpiGuid,
  33. 0,
  34. NULL,
  35. (VOID **) &SiPreMemPolicy
  36. );
  37. if (EFI_ERROR (Status)) {
  38. return EFI_NOT_FOUND;
  39. }
  40. Status = GetConfigBlock ((VOID *) SiPreMemPolicy, &gMePeiPreMemConfigGuid, (VOID *) &MePeiPreMemConfig);
  41. ASSERT_EFI_ERROR (Status);
  42. FspmUpd->FspmConfig.HeciTimeouts = (UINT8) MePeiPreMemConfig->HeciTimeouts;
  43. //
  44. // Test policies
  45. //
  46. FspmUpd->FspmTestConfig.DidInitStat = (UINT8) MePeiPreMemConfig->DidInitStat;
  47. FspmUpd->FspmTestConfig.DisableCpuReplacedPolling = (UINT8) MePeiPreMemConfig->DisableCpuReplacedPolling;
  48. FspmUpd->FspmTestConfig.SendDidMsg = (UINT8) MePeiPreMemConfig->SendDidMsg;
  49. FspmUpd->FspmTestConfig.DisableMessageCheck = (UINT8) MePeiPreMemConfig->DisableMessageCheck;
  50. FspmUpd->FspmTestConfig.SkipMbpHob = (UINT8) MePeiPreMemConfig->SkipMbpHob;
  51. FspmUpd->FspmTestConfig.HeciCommunication2 = (UINT8) MePeiPreMemConfig->HeciCommunication2;
  52. FspmUpd->FspmTestConfig.KtDeviceEnable = (UINT8) MePeiPreMemConfig->KtDeviceEnable;
  53. FspmUpd->FspmConfig.Heci1BarAddress = MePeiPreMemConfig->Heci1BarAddress;
  54. FspmUpd->FspmConfig.Heci2BarAddress = MePeiPreMemConfig->Heci2BarAddress;
  55. FspmUpd->FspmConfig.Heci3BarAddress = MePeiPreMemConfig->Heci3BarAddress;
  56. return EFI_SUCCESS;
  57. }
  58. /**
  59. Performs FSP ME PEI Policy initialization.
  60. @param[in][out] FspsUpd Pointer to FSP UPD Data.
  61. @retval EFI_SUCCESS FSP UPD Data is updated.
  62. @retval EFI_NOT_FOUND Fail to locate required PPI.
  63. @retval Other FSP UPD Data update process fail.
  64. **/
  65. EFI_STATUS
  66. EFIAPI
  67. PeiFspMePolicyInit (
  68. IN OUT FSPS_UPD *FspsUpd
  69. )
  70. {
  71. EFI_STATUS Status;
  72. SI_POLICY_PPI *SiPolicyPpi;
  73. ME_PEI_CONFIG *MePeiConfig;
  74. DEBUG ((DEBUG_INFO, "PeiFspMePolicyInit \n"));
  75. //
  76. // Locate gSiPolicyPpiGuid
  77. //
  78. SiPolicyPpi = NULL;
  79. Status = PeiServicesLocatePpi (
  80. &gSiPolicyPpiGuid,
  81. 0,
  82. NULL,
  83. (VOID **) &SiPolicyPpi
  84. );
  85. if (EFI_ERROR (Status)) {
  86. return EFI_NOT_FOUND;
  87. }
  88. Status = GetConfigBlock ((VOID *) SiPolicyPpi, &gMePeiConfigGuid, (VOID *) &MePeiConfig);
  89. ASSERT_EFI_ERROR (Status);
  90. FspsUpd->FspsConfig.Heci3Enabled = (UINT8) MePeiConfig->Heci3Enabled;
  91. FspsUpd->FspsConfig.MeUnconfigOnRtcClear = (UINT8) MePeiConfig->MeUnconfigOnRtcClear;
  92. //
  93. // Test policies
  94. //
  95. FspsUpd->FspsTestConfig.MctpBroadcastCycle = (UINT8) MePeiConfig->MctpBroadcastCycle;
  96. FspsUpd->FspsTestConfig.EndOfPostMessage = (UINT8) MePeiConfig->EndOfPostMessage;
  97. FspsUpd->FspsTestConfig.DisableD0I3SettingForHeci = (UINT8) MePeiConfig->DisableD0I3SettingForHeci;
  98. return EFI_SUCCESS;
  99. }
